Ham pizza recipe
-
Preparation:
10 minutes
-
Cooking time:
20 minutes
-
Difficulty
level:
-
½ cup (125 ml) store-bought pizza sauce
-
1 tbsp. pesto
-
1 pizza dough, precooked or fresh (store-bought)
-
2 green onions
-
1 cup (250 ml) Paris (white) mushrooms, sliced
-
3 cups (750 ml) mozzarella, cheddar and Gruyère, grated
-
1 cup (250 ml) ham, cut into strips or thin slices
-
Salt and pepper
-
Mix pizza sauce and pesto in a bowl, and salt and pepper to taste.
-
Spread sauce mixture on pizza dough, then garnish with ham.
-
In a bowl, combine grated cheeses. Spread half the mixture on the pizza.
-
Add mushrooms and green onions, then remainder of the cheese.
-
Bake on middle oven rack at 450°F for 7 to 10 minutes (or until top is golden brown) if dough is precooked, or for 15 to 20 minutes if dough is fresh.
-
Let cool for 5 minutes, then serve with a salad.
